1. Mattancherry Palace
What’s Special: Artefacts and Embellishments of Kings
Nearby Attractions: Ernakulam Cemetery Church, St. Mary’s Cathedral Basilica, Ramakrishna Math
Entry Fees: Adults: INR 2 ; Children (Upto 15 years): Free
Timings: 10:00 am to 05:00 pm (Closed on Fridays)
Built By: Portuguese
Built In: 1555
Houses: Paintings, Artefacts, Exhibits
Distance From City Center: 3 kms
Transportation Options: Taxi, Cab, Auto Rickshaw
Mattancherry Palace was made by Portuguese rulers as a palace and now it has been converted into a museum. The artefacts and paintings inside the palace tell us about the Kochi kings and the history of Kochi rulers. There is also a big courtyard and a temple inside the Mattancherry Palace.
2. Chinese Fishing Nets
What’s Special: Sunset views
Nearby Attractions: Vasco da Gama Square, Mattancherry Palace, Fort Kochi Beach
Entry Fees: Free
Timings: 24 Hours
Distance From Airport: 36.3 kms
Transportation Options: Tuk-tuk, Taxi
Chinese Fishing Nets is a phenomenal sight to watch in Kochi when the huge nets with mesmerizing sunset view in the backdrop look heavenly beautiful. You will see a lot of fishermen catching fish through these giant fishing nets. It is a great place for fine photography.
3. Willingdon Island
What’s Special: Natural beauty, Lavish hotels
Nearby Attractions: St. Francis Church, Mattancherry Palace, Indo-Portuguese Museum, Hill Palace Museum, Santa Cruz Cathedral Basilica
Entry Fees: Free
Timings: 05:00 am to 10:00 pm
Built By: Sir Robert Bristow
Built In: 1936
Houses: Cruises, Hotels Commercial and Industrial buildings
Distance From Airport: 40 kms
Transportation Options: Ferry
Willingdon Island serves as the base of the Koci navy. It also serves as the commercial port link between various national and international ports. This is a man-made island which looks stunning and the sunset views from the island is something worth-noticing.

5. Bolgatty Palace
What’s Special: Lavish rooms
Nearby Attractions: Vallarpadam Church, Infant Jesus Church, St. Mary’s Cathedral Basilica
Entry Fees: Depends on the rooms booked
Timings: 24 Hours
Built By: Dutch Traders
Built In: 1744
Houses: Gardens, Lavish rooms
Distance From City Center: 2 kms
Transportation Options: Taxi, Tuk-tuk
Bolgatty Palace is one of the oldest surviving Dutch palaces in India. The architecture of the palace is a mix of Kochi style of architecture and also the Dutch. The palace has served as the Governor's palace before and now it has been converted into a luxury hotel. The palace is also surrounded by gardens and has been divided into three major parts.

1. Enjoy the vivid nightlife
Kochi is home to numerous bars and nightclubs for night owls and party animals. If you wish to capture true experiences of Kochi nightlife then you can plan a sneak peek at the Taj Malabar, Jules Bar in Le Meridien, and the Ava Lounge. These are some of the finest places to hang out with your friends, family and loved ones while in Kochi.
2. Witness a Classical Dance Show
Kerala is known for its cultural experiences. You can witness Kathakali and Kalaripayattu, the two grand forms of dance in South India that showcase the cultural aspect and are definitely worth watching. The rich jewellery and gorgeous outfits worn during these dance performances will surely delight you.
3. Stroll through the Marine Drive
Spend leisure time by the Marine Drive by strolling with your travel mates. If you seeking a quiet night out, then gaze at the starlit sky at the Marine Drive. Let the calm ocean breeze flow through your face and you just relax and sit and gaze at the beauty of the moon and stars as the Marine Drive in Kochi is quiet and pleasant during the night.
4. Enjoy shopping in Kochi
Shopping can an exciting activity to indulge in here as one gets to shop a lot from the local markets in Kochi. The top things to buy from Kochi are spices, banana chips, handloom, handicrafts, and cane products. The best markets to shop in Kochi are Cochin Spice Market, Jew Town, and Marine Drive.
